Spoiled Meat forms naturally when raw meat spoils in inventory or storage. Rather than waste it, admins can use it to feed creatures that prefer or require spoiled flesh, or incorporate it into certain recipes.
Spawn it directly with its numeric item ID (13) using GiveItem, or use the GFI code if your server prefers that method. The stack size is not limited, so you can hand out quantities as needed for farming or testing.
